Potřebuji vyřešit zajímavý problém na mém webu: na www.flagrantni.wz.cz/diskuze/reakce se v horní liste nad textem, která popisuje zanořování je přidán styl odstavece (lista je zformátovaný odstavec) - IE6 to zobrazí přesně tak, jak je to nadef. s pozadím, zatímco Mozilla (o které si myslím, že od jisté doby zobrazuje stránky lépe a standardněji oproti IE) listu zobrazí bez barvy a obrázku v pozadí - nechápu tu.
Další problém je na stránce http://www.flagrantni.wz.cz/uvahy/skolne-vs-nespasi.htm: úplně dole jsou "blokové" odkazy jako tlačitka, oba dva jsou v odstavci, kterým IE přiděluje dědičné okraje, zatímco Mozilla nedědí okraje. Co je špatně, resp. jaký prohlížeč to interpretuje lépe?
Ad 1
<p id="lista"><a href="../index.htm">Diskuze</a> → <strong>Reakce</strong></p>
#lista
{padding: 5px 0 6px 25px;
margin: 2px 1px 0px 18px;
border-bottom: 1px solid #fff;
font-size: 11px;
line-height: 1em;
background: #ecedf0 url('img/menu-active.gif') left 1px repeat-y}
Ad2
<p class="podclanek"><a href="javascript:blank('../vzkaz.htm');">reagovat na článek</a>
<a href="index.htm">zpět do tématické sekce</a></p>
.podclanek
{margin: auto auto auto 110px} Je rozdíl pro nějaký prohlížeč v zápisu
{margin-left: 110px}
(...)
Velmi děkuji za analýzu a ODPOVĚĎ
Jirka
>> padding: 5px 0 6px 25px;
ne spíš takto:
padding: 5px 0px 6px 25px;
>>ne spíš takto:
>>padding: 5px 0px 6px 25px;
ak je rozmer nastavovany na 0, nie je potrebne zadavat jednotky. 0 vzdy bude 0 :-)
ani nie napr validator vypise chybu
Když je hodnota nulová, žádná jednotka tam být nemusí.
Když je délka 0 tak validátor chybu nevypíše !